Sexting and its Consequences
- Sexting has real consequences. In some cases, sexting may cause emotional distress if the sender’s images or messages are forwarded on to unintentional audiences.
- Sexting between a minor (someone under 18) and an adult violates child pornography laws in most states, regardless of whether the images sent or received were consensual. The consequences of this behavior, whether sending or receiving, are real and could be long-term.
- Talk to your kids about the serious consequences of sexting, create family rules and use parental monitoring/management tools. By proactively addressing inappropriate sexting before it becomes an issue, parents and kids can help prevent it from happening.
